Pharmacy technicians measure, mix, count, label, and record medications in accordance with prescription orders and under the direction of the pharmacist. They are also responsible for recording inventory data and prepacking bulk medicines along with typing and affixing labels. NC State is located in the Research Triangle in the Raleigh-Durham area ...Durham University has 17 colleges, of which University College is the oldest, founded in 1832. The newest college is South, founded in 2020. The last single-sex college, St Mary's, became mixed in 2005 with the admittance of male undergraduates. One college, Ustinov, admits only postgraduates .Durham Technical Community College is accredited by the Southern Association of Colleges and Schools Commission on Colleges (SACSCOC) to award associate degrees, diplomas and certificates. Durham Technical Community College doesn't offer on campus housing. If you're not living with family you will need to budget for food and housing in the Durham area just like you would for a college with dorms. The estimated rent and meal expense per academic year for off campus housing is $10,872. Books and Supplies. Short-term health insurance is not a major medical insurance alternative to the Affordable Care Act (Obamacare). Whether you need coverage during …The NC Broker License is a multi-status license. Upon course completion and passing the final exam students qualify to take the NC real estate exam. After passing the NC real estate exam a provisional Broker license is issued. The provisional status is removed upon successful completion of three required Post-Licensing courses taken within 18 ...Our Colleges are at the heart of life at Durham. BioAg Technology is a 148-hour set of modular courses designed to prepare students with the training necessary to obtain employment in the ag-tech or biotech industries. Topics include plant biology, soils and growing media, controlled environmental agriculture (CEA), pest control and work-based learning experiences. Main Campus.
